What happened
New York City has initiated a comprehensive investigation into Polymarket and other prediction markets, focusing on their marketing practices and potential targeting of minors. This inquiry is part of a broader examination of the industry, which has raised concerns about insider trading and gambling among young audiences. The investigation specifically targets four prediction markets operating within the city, indicating the extensive nature of the scrutiny.
The Commodity Futures Trading Commission (CFTC) has also expressed concerns regarding compliance practices in the prediction market industry. This dual scrutiny from both local and federal entities underscores the seriousness of the allegations and the potential ramifications for the involved platforms.
The Context
The investigation encompasses multiple prediction markets, notably Polymarket and Kalshi, as authorities seek to address the implications of their marketing strategies. Concerns have been mounting about the appeal of these platforms to minors, prompting the NYC Council to consider stricter regulations. The timing of this investigation coincides with heightened awareness of compliance issues within the industry, as highlighted by the CFTC's recent warnings.
As the landscape of prediction markets evolves, the actions taken by New York City could set a precedent for how these platforms operate in the future. The focus on protecting vulnerable populations, particularly minors, reflects a broader societal concern regarding gambling and its accessibility.
